Abstract

The utility model relates to an agricultural device for seeding and fertilizing, in particular to a dibbler for seeding and fertilizing of the corn interplanting. The utility model comprises a machine frame, a seed and fertilizer box, an opening share, a fertilizer discharging tub, a seed discharging tub, etc. The utility model is characterized in that a land wheel is driven before using, a fore land wheel, a fertilizing wheel shaft, and a seeding wheel shaft are connected with the transmission of a chainwheel and a chain, and a front chainwheel and the land wheel can be engaged or separated through a shifting fork type clutch. The utility model has the advantages of simple driving mode and structure, small size, and light weight. Besides, the planting distance and the row space can be adjusted effectively.

Description

Dibbler for maize seed fertilizer
The utility model relates to the general agricultural machinery of sowing, fertilising, particularly adapts to the kind of interplanting corn, fertile planter.
There is a kind of corn planter of little four-wheel traction in China at present, and it is fit to large tracts of land sowing corn uses, and interplanting corn is improper.The also single file of the manpower of promising interplanting corn or animal-drawn, duplicate rows planter, the type of drive of these planters is four bar linkages basically, or the type of drive of the two places wheel drive fertilization wheel axis of frame both sides and sowing wheel shaft, four bar linkages are difficult for realizing clutch, make loom when breaking, as long as land wheel rotates, fertilising is taken turns and seeding wheel must rotate, seed, fertilizer just constantly fall, have only complete machine is mentioned, just can address the above problem, simultaneously this type of drive spacing in the rows is adjusted difficulty, brings a lot of inconvenience to use.Two places, frame both sides wheel drive structure makes that seed manure spacing ground is higher, and defeated kind, fertile pipe are longer, plants, fertile freely to fall distance also longer, and it is inhomogeneous to cause spacing in the rows to become different.
It is simple in structure that the purpose of this utility model provides a kind of type of drive, easily realizes clutch, easily adjusts spacing in the rows, kind, the fertile planter of the interplanting corn of in light weight, easy to operate a kind of suitable people, animal power traction.
Realize that scheme of the present utility model is: fixed installation seeding and fertilizing case on frame, separate with dividing plate before and after the seeding and fertilizing case, first half is a fertilizing box, latter half of is Seeding box, in the fertilizing box bottom fertilising wheel is arranged, the fertilising wheel is contained on the fertilization wheel axis, the other fertilizer scraper that is equipped with of fertilising wheel, in the Seeding box bottom seeding wheel is arranged, seeding wheel is contained on the sowing wheel shaft, the other installation of seeding wheel scraped kind of a sheet, fertilization wheel axis, the sowing wheel shaft is installed on the frame sill by axle sleeve, at fertilizer scraper, scrape furrower is installed respectively under the housiung separator under kind of the sheet, defertilizing tube and discharging tube, be installed with trailing bar and press wheel before and after on discharging tube afer bay sill, characteristics are that driving wheel adopts preceding land wheel, preceding land wheel is fixedly mounted on the tooth fork type clutch, clutch is movably arranged on the preceding land axle by axle sleeve, the clutch shifter end is fixedlyed connected with the preceding sprocket wheel be movably arranged on preceding land axle by axle sleeve on, clutch operating lever is fixedlyed connected by rod member with the clutch shifter end, preceding sprocket wheel, fertilization wheel axis, the sowing wheel shaft is by being installed in the intermediate chain wheel on the fertilization wheel axis, fertilising sprocket wheel and be installed in sowing sprocket wheel and the chain drive sowed on the wheel shaft and be connected.
By animal power or manpower traction preceding land wheel is rotated, the rotation of preceding land wheel and then rotates the preceding sprocket wheel that is installed on the land axle by tooth fork type clutch mechanism again, thereby fertilising sprocket rotation by the chain drive connection, the fertilising sprocket rotation drives fertilization wheel axis and rotates fertilization wheel axis rotation passing through again chain, the transmission of sowing sprocket wheel is rotated the sowing wheel shaft, fertilization wheel axis, the rotation of sowing wheel shaft, feasible fixed installation fertilising wheel thereon, seeding wheel rotates, their rotation, make sowing, fertilizer in the fertilizing box and seed are along the fertilising wheel, fertilizer scraper and seeding wheel, scrape kind of sheet and defertilizing tube, discharging tube successively falls into the disposable kind of finishing of trench that furrower is left, fatbits is broadcast task, by replacing the sprocket wheel of different-diameter, land wheel before making, fertilization wheel axis, the gearratio of sowing wheel shaft obtains changing, thereby reached the purpose that changes the sowing spacing in the rows, if tooth fork type clutch separation, though land wheel rotates, the fertilising wheel, seeding wheel does not rotate.
Advantage of the present utility model is that this machine adopts the type of drive of preceding land wheel, tooth fork type clutch, sprocket wheel, chain drive fertilising wheel, seeding wheel, simple in structure, can carry out quantitatively, locate, apply fertilizer, sow, realize according to preceding land wheel travel distance kind, nutriment in a fertilizer layer branch broadcast purpose, can adjust spacing in the rows and line-spacing effectively, volume is little, in light weight, easy to operate, is a kind of comparatively ideal corn kind, the fertile planter that uses when being fit to farmers''s interplanting corn.
